Wednesday's Australian Q2 CPI release is the single most important near-term catalyst: a hotter-than-expected core print (above 3.7% YoY) could reprice RBA rate hike expectations and fuel a clean break above 0.7000, while a soft print risks a swift reversal back toward the 200-day SMA at 0.6900.

AUDUSD is pinned at the critical 0.7000 psychological resistance level — a zone that has consistently rejected rallies — while the RBA's Q2 CPI print on Wednesday will determine whether bulls can sustain a breakout or bears reclaim the 200-day SMA at 0.6900.

Main Risk

Australian Q2 CPI Release (Wednesday)

A core CPI print above the expected 3.7% annual rate would force hawkish RBA repricing and could propel AUDUSD through the 0.7000 resistance and toward the 2026 swing high near 0.7185; a miss below 3.5% would trigger sharp selling.
